  • Title

    Patterning nano-domains with orthogonal functionalities: Solventless synthesis of self-sorting surfaces

  • Abstract
    Vapor deposited functional polymer thin films can undergo rapid covalent functionalization. Patterning of two functional layers displaying orthogonal reactivity enables sorting of aqueous mixtures of dyes and nanoparticles, such as quantum dots, onto selective areas of nanopatterned surfaces.
